Childhood is full of taking risks and reaching out. For a child, everything’s new. Making friends, talking to people outside the family, being sad, trying to draw a picture, climbing high, running fast. So is handling a hammer, a bicycle, and a sharp knife. Taking risks is how kids learn new things. Risk is not the problem. Risk is necessary to life. The key is to separate fear from risk and healthy risk from dangerous risk.
